Output 51ecfb4b112b43eed3ba34dc7d57181ade4d0095fe6bac975b8d0395259d929a:1

value
23408123
script pubkey
OP_0 OP_PUSHBYTES_20 92a06ccd523365793030cb5a3f94f168d695f6b9
address
ltc1qj2sxen2jxdjhjvpseddrl983drtfta4e55wnq3
transaction
51ecfb4b112b43eed3ba34dc7d57181ade4d0095fe6bac975b8d0395259d929a
spent
true